What users say about SignEasy
Based on user reviews (G2, Capterra, and other platforms).
Strengths
- Best-in-class ease of use and mobile-first signing
- Genuinely shipped AI for signing teams (summaries, key-term extraction, Smart Q&A)
- Affordable transparent per-seat pricing with a real free tier
Weaknesses
- Signed documents hard to find and organize (per reviews)
- Obligation tracking stops at in-app reminders, no calendar sync
- Thin collaboration (no redlining); advanced features gated to higher tiers

Why choose Contracko over SignEasy?
SignEasy is an easy-to-use signing tool that has added genuine AI, summaries, key-term extraction, Smart Q&A, AI search, and renewal reminders, which puts it closer to contract management than most signing tools. Where it falls short is depth: reviewers say signed contracts are hard to find and organize, obligation tracking stops at in-app reminders with no calendar sync, and there is no redlining. Contracko competes on that depth, calendar-synced obligation and renewal management, deeper risk analysis, and reporting across the whole portfolio.
